Dupont Circle South gets hot

Article Abstract:

The area where Connecticut Ave intersects with 18th St in Washington, DC, has attracted a substantial number of pre-dawn patrons because of new restaurants which have nearly doubled the number of night spots there. The new eateries include Andalu, Dragonfly and MCCXXIII.

How to meet a Harvard man

Article Abstract:

The Ivy League Over 30s singles event is an opportunity for people to socialize and network with others. Although the event is devoted to Ivy Leaguers, even outsiders can sneak their way in. Those in attendance are observed to pounce on the free pizza once it is served.
